DOMDocument::append
Appends nodes after the last child node
Description
public void DOMDocument::append(DOMNodestring ...$nodes
)
Parameters
-
nodes
-
The nodes to append.
Strings are automatically converted to text nodes.
Return Values
No value is returned.
Errors/Exceptions
-
DOM_HIERARCHY_REQUEST_ERR
-
Raised if this node is of a type that does not allow children of the
type of one of the passed nodes
, or if the node to
put in is one of this node's ancestors or this node itself.
-
DOM_WRONG_DOCUMENT_ERR
-
Raised if one of the passed nodes
was created from a different
document than the one that created this node.
Examples
Example #1 DOMDocument::append example
Adds nodes after the document root.
<?php
$doc = new DOMDocument;
$doc->loadXML("<hello/>");
$doc->append("beautiful", $doc->createElement("world"));
echo $doc->saveXML();
?>
The above example will output:
<hello/>
beautiful
<world/>
See Also
- DOMParentNode::append
- DOMDocument::prepend